Output 58f3dbcdf5b646c009b0bb11acd69187bcc3d366316daf15719cdb155ac6cfad:0

value
685664
script pubkey
OP_0 OP_PUSHBYTES_20 caad45444be717a25d4c679b46c959a51a558069
address
bc1qe2k523ztuut6yh2vv7d5dj2e55d9tqrfdf338w
transaction
58f3dbcdf5b646c009b0bb11acd69187bcc3d366316daf15719cdb155ac6cfad
spent
true